EXCO Resources (XCO) Misses Q4 EPS by 1c, to Cut Workforce by 15%

February 24, 2015 4:48 PM EST

EXCO Resources (NYSE: XCO) reported Q4 EPS of ($0.02), $0.01 worse than the analyst estimate of ($0.01). Revenue for the quarter came in at $127.8 million versus the consensus estimate of $138.89 million.

"We were proactive in amending our credit agreement to provide us with the liquidity and financial flexibility to persevere through the current market conditions. In order to maximize our cash flows in this commodity price environment, we have negotiated reductions in operating and capital costs and will continue to pursue further reductions. Also, we have implemented initiatives to reduce our general and administrative costs including a 15% reduction in our workforce during 2015. Our deep inventory of high-quality drilling opportunities will provide a platform for significant growth when prices recover. We also plan to be opportunistic as we evaluate acquisitions that meet our strategic and financial objectives."

Our actual capital expenditures for the fourth quarter 2014 and full year 2014, and 2015 capital budget are presented in the following table.

(in thousands) Fourth Quarter 2014 Full Year 2014 2015 Budget
Capital expenditures:
Development capital $106,697 $356,344 $215,000
Field operations, gathering and water pipelines 3,330 20,256 16,000
Lease purchases and seismic 3,233 10,477 7,000
Corporate and other (1) 8,347 37,198 37,000
Total capital expenditures $121,607 $424,275 $275,000
